“I have been hit, tortured, humiliated – I’m always the first to wake up and the last to go to sleep,” explains Habi Mutraba, breaking into tears.

Miss Mutraba is from the West African state of Mauritania, and, like an estimated 600,000 of her fellow citizens, was enslaved from birth.

Her mother was impregnated by her “master” and when Habi was born she was given to a member of his extended family.

Like most other Mauritanian slaves, Habi would tend to her master’s livestock or work in the household, fetching water and preparing food.

She says she was regularly raped by the head of her household after he threatened her with a knife and later on became pregnant by his son following another rape.

“None of us ever went to school,” she said in an interview with the Telegraph, “none of us had identity or civil papers.

“I received no support, no one could help me. I was totally at the mercy of my masters.”

Habi’s experiences are not unique. Officially, Mauritania made human slavery illegal in 1981 – the last country in the world to do so.

However, it did not introduce criminal laws enforcing the ruling until 2007 and the anti-slavery NGO SOS-Esclaves estimates the number of those enslaved in the country is still as high as 600,000 or 18 per cent of the nation’s population - more than any other country in the world.

The culture of slavery in Mauritania dates back hundreds of years and is passed along family lines, with slaves like Miss Mutraba born into servitude.
